Rover Dramawerks concludes their 21st season with the comedy Kosher Lutherans by William Missouri Downs.

Hanna and Franklyn are a seemingly perfect couple who desperately want to have a child of their own, but are unable to do so. One day their dreams come true: they meet a young, naïve, pregnant girl from Iowa who offers to let them adopt her out-of-wedlock baby. Just before the adoption papers are signed, they discover she doesn’t know they’re Jewish. In a desperate attempt not to blow the deal, the couple, “aided” by their Jewish friends Ben and Martha, decide to pose as Lutherans to appeal to the girl's apparent Midwestern sensibilities, leading to some hysterical twists and turns.
